Go Clubs For Everyone!
November 2023
Congratulations to the 14 Go Clubs recipients that will share in almost $240,000 as part of the 2023/24 Infrastructure Assistance Grant.
Babinda Bowls Club – $4,173 (ex GST) for the replacement of water pipes
Cairns and Districts Senior Citizens Association – $25,000 for re-tiling old and damaged floors
Cairns Brass – $25,000 for bathroom renovations
Cairns Cycling Club – $17,127 for the installation of solar panels
Cairns Motorcycling Club – $25,000 for resurfacing track works
Earlville Tennis Club – $25,000 for upgrading of kitchen facilities
Gordonvale Turf Club – $7,000 (ex GST) for caretakers' residence rectification works
Holloways-Cairns Croquet Club – $9,343 for outdoor amenities improvements
Leichhardt Football Club – $5,000 for a storage container
Marlin Coast Meals on Wheels – $23,827 (ex GST) for replacing existing kitchen flooring
Redlynch Equestrian Association – $15,400 for replacement of the equestrian round yard
Saints Hockey Club – $19,548 for constructing a storage shed
Stratford Dolphins Football Club – $21,864 (ex GST) for LED field lighting upgrade
Top of the State Rod and Custom Car Club – $14,877 for the installation of solar panels.
